> Hi everyone, I hope I'm putting this in the right place - I'm still waiting for my > account to be verified so I can post this to mametesters. > > Running rungun2 from the command line with "mame64 rungun2" spits out a ton of errors > when you get to gameplay that look like this: > GXT4: unknown protection command 125c (PC=209948) > GXT4: unknown protection command 3a56 (PC=209948) > GXT4: unknown protection command 1b55 (PC=209948) > GXT4: unknown protection command 3357 (PC=209948) > > I saw this reported in the bug tracker, and the comments there made it sound like it > shouldn't be that big of a deal, BUT when you run the game from the built-in GUI, it > runs WAY faster than from the command line. When I run it from the GUI, I get 160% > speed during gameplay (leaving plenty of headroom for 60fps all the time), and when I > run it from the command line, I only wind up with about 70% speed (making the game > unplayable). > > Does anyone know what's going on with this or how to disable the error messages from > showing up? I can't just "run it from the GUI" because I'm using a different > front-end for my games and obviously they get run from the command line. > > Any help is most appreciated! Thanks!
printf spam to console window takes emulation cycles, no doubt about it. If you capture the output to a file it should react the same as the GUI [ > output.txt 2>&1 ]. But, in this case, since it isn't under active development - commenting the printf should be ok.
I'll see that it is changed - no need to log a bug about it.
